Six critical in blast during illegal firecracker preparation in Odisha
Bhubaneswar, April 3 -- A powerful explosion during firecracker preparation left at least six persons critically injured at Korada village under Nuagaon police station limits in Odisha's Nayagarh district on Friday.
The blast occurred inside a house at Korada village where firecrackers were being made unlawfully.
The incident took place when preparation was underway for the upcoming 'Lanka Podi' festival scheduled on April 7.
Among the injured are two women; all six have been admitted to the District Headquarters Hospital in critical condition.
